Mount Helena, WA had 3,373 residents at the 2021 Census, with the broader statistical area showing a 7.5% growth over the last five years. The predominant age group is 55-64 years, and the median age sits at 41. Households are most often couples with children, and those with a mortgage repay a median of $2,048 a month. Around 89.3% of homes are owner-occupied, with the largest single tenure being owned with a mortgage at 55.0%. Most dwellings are separate houses, making up 100.0% of the suburb's housing stock. The suburb has 2 parks and reserves mapped within its boundary. Source: ABS Census 2021 and Estimated Resident Population, with amenity counts from state Open Data and OpenStreetMap.
